Course Details
Topic 1 Automate development tasks by using GitHub Actions
- How does GitHub Actions automate development tasks?
- Identify the components of GitHub Actions
- Configure a GitHub Actions workflow
- Create and run a basic GitHub Actions workflow
Topic 2 Build continuous integration (CI) workflows by using GitHub Actions
- How do I use GitHub Actions to create workflows for CI?
- Customize your workflow with environment variables and artifact data
- Create the CI workflow on GitHub
Topic 3 Build and deploy applications to Azure by using GitHub Actions
- How do I use GitHub Actions to deploy to Azure?
- Remove artifacts, create status badges, and configure environment protections
- Create a workflow that deploys a web app to Azure
Topic 4 Automate GitHub by using GitHub Script
- What is GitHub Script?
- Using GitHub Script in GitHub Actions
Topic 5 Leverage GitHub Actions to publish to GitHub Packages
- What is GitHub Packages?
- Publish to GitHub Packages and GitHub Container Registry
- Knowledge check
- Publish to a GitHub Packages registry
- GitHub Packages for code packages
Topic 6 Create and publish custom GitHub actions
- Create a custom GitHub action
- Publish a custom GitHub action
- Create a custom JavaScript GitHub action
Topic 7 Manage GitHub Actions in the enterprise
- Manage actions and workflows
- Manage runners
- Manage encrypted secrets
- Use a repository secret in a GitHub Actions workflow
Course Info
Promotion Code
Your will get 10% discount voucher for 2nd course onwards if you write us a Google review.
Minimum Entry Requirement
Knowledge and Skills
- Able to operate using computer functions
- Minimum 3 GCE ‘O’ Levels Passes including English or WPL Level 5 (Average of Reading, Listening, Speaking & Writing Scores)
Attitude
- Positive Learning Attitude
- Enthusiastic Learner
Experience
- Minimum of 1 year of working experience.
Target Age Group: 18-65 years old
Minimum Software/Hardware Requirement
Software:
free Microsoft Azure account (https://azure.microsoft.com/en-us/) hereHardware: Window or Mac Laptops
Job Roles
- DevOps Engineer
- Software Developer
- Automation Engineer
- CI/CD Engineer
- Cloud Engineer
- System Administrator
- Site Reliability Engineer (SRE)
- IT Operations Engineer
- Platform Engineer
- Security Engineer
- Application Developer
- Technical Lead
- GitHub Administrator
- IT Project Manager
- QA Engineer
- Release Manager
- Cloud Architect
- Infrastructure Engineer
- Software Tester
- Technical Support Engineer
Trainers
Ajay B : Ajay is a ACLP certied trainer. Ajay is a vendor neutral cloud consultant and training expert on Cloud , with several Private cloud deployments in India and cloud migration knowledge .He is a Cloud and DevOps enthusiast with consulting, deployment and training expertise on OpenStack, AWS, Google Cloud ,Azure, Jenkins, and Docker
Ajay has 18 + years Industry experience as IT entrepreneur and 9 years in Cloud and Devops technical consulting, implementation and training area, currently working in capacity of Vice President – Cloud and Devops services handling singapore and India
Anil Bidari: Anil is a ACLP certified trainer. He is an Enterprise Cloud and DevOps Consultant , responsible for helping clients to move Virtual data centre to Private Cloud based on OpenStack and Public Cloud ( AWS, Azure and Google cloud) . Consulting and training experience on Devops tool chain like github , Jenkins, Sonarqube, Docker & kubernetes, Cloud foundry, Openshift, Ansible and SaltStack. Lot of my Role is involved design and implementation of a solution and training




